General Information: Temp: Mesophile; Habitat: Host. Pectobacterium carotovorum causes soft-rot diseases of various plant hosts through degradation of the plant cell walls. Formerly Erwinia, these organisms are plant-specific pathogens that invade the vascular systems of plants. Pectobacterium colonize the intercellular spaces of plant cells and deliver potent effector molecules (Avr - avirulence) through a type III secretion system (Hrp - hypersensitive response and pathogenicity). Avr proteins control host-bacterium interactions, including host range. Expression of the plant cell-wall-degrading enzymes is controlled through a quorum-sensing mechanism that quantifies the number of Pectobacterium bacteria through measurement of the concentration of small molecules (acyl homoserine lactones) produced by Pectobacterium.
